A massive power outage has hit Spain and Portugal. Authorities have been trying to restore their power grids since the mass outage started around noon on 28th April.

According to the media, train services were suspended, flights delayed, and traffic lights knocked out in many areas. Spain's nuclear safety council said the country's reactors are safe. Officials say, after some of the reactors stopped operating, emergency generators kicked in.

Spanish Prime Minister Pedro Sanchez said power is being restored to parts of the country, thanks to supplies from neighboring countries including France. Sanchez said there is so far no conclusive information on the cause of the blackout.  Spanish media outlets reported that this was the worst power outage in Spanish history.
